Schneider Electric TSXAMZ600 CPU: Application-Focused Overview
The Schneider Electric TSXAMZ600 CPU is an advanced analog I/O module specifically engineered for the Modicon TSX Micro automation platform, making it an essential component for industrial automation applications. This module excels in environments that require precise management of analog signals, offering engineers a reliable solution to meet the demands of modern automation systems.
Practical Applications and Use Cases
The TSXAMZ600 is ideally suited for a variety of industrial applications, including material handling, packaging, and textile machinery. Its four analog input channels and two analog output channels allow for seamless integration with diverse sensor and actuator configurations. This flexibility enables engineers to implement effective control strategies across multiple processes, from monitoring environmental conditions to regulating machinery operations.
Input and Output Capabilities
Engineers will appreciate the module's versatility in handling various signal types, including 0...10 V, 4...20 mA, 0...20 mA, and ±10 V. This compatibility ensures that the TSXAMZ600 can interface with a wide range of industrial sensors and actuators, facilitating smooth data acquisition and control. The ability to process multiple signal types simultaneously enhances operational efficiency and simplifies system design.
Performance and Precision
With an 11-bit analog-to-digital conversion resolution, the TSXAMZ600 ensures high accuracy in signal processing, which is critical for applications that rely on precise data. The module's acquisition period of 16 ms and rapid response time of 400 µs make it particularly suitable for dynamic environments where quick data handling is essential. This performance characteristic allows engineers to implement real-time monitoring and control, significantly improving process responsiveness.
Reliability and Protection
Designed for demanding industrial environments, the TSXAMZ600 features robust short-circuit protection for both input and output signals, safeguarding the module and connected devices from electrical faults. Its ability to maintain stability under varying temperature conditions, along with minimal temperature drift, ensures consistent performance across a range of operating environments. The 1000 V AC isolation voltage further enhances safety, making it a dependable choice for critical applications.
Energy Efficiency and Sustainability
With a current consumption of only 180 mA, the TSXAMZ600 is energy-efficient, aligning with industry standards for sustainability. While it adheres to RoHS compliance, reflecting a commitment to reducing hazardous materials in manufacturing, its design also supports energy conservation efforts in industrial settings.
